Output 330372ee40792dcaf13611d84c90a8c0612c6c8f8ade86f8a8c1e8a667c4031a:686

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9598ce3236e378d10f3c6e97cfb214c89fe755db OP_EQUAL
address
3FL1fEccTQWh1vgWGwXYQPspekoxFw2A5o
transaction
330372ee40792dcaf13611d84c90a8c0612c6c8f8ade86f8a8c1e8a667c4031a
confirmations
236556
spent
true